Our client is a leading manufacturer of special purpose machinery and due to their continued expansion, Staffbase have been appointed to recruit for the position of Aftersales and Engineering Administrator.
The Role: The Aftersales and Engineering Administrator will work closely with the sales, service, engineering and spare parts teams and you will effectively organise and control after-sales activities. Key responsibilities will include but are not limited to the following:
- Effectively process all after sales enquiries undertaking tasks such as producing quotations, ordering spare parts, chasing suppliers, allocating resources to work.
- Effective management and control of spare parts in line with technical specifications.
- Assist with online marketing campaigns, website and online brochure updates.
- Provide project management support, coordinate installations, resource allocation, logistics.
- Monitor performance and produce accurate KPI reports.
- Establish and maintain excellent customer relationships.
Candidate: We are looking for an Aftersales and Engineering Administrator with a minimum of 2-3 years experience and ideally with some exposure to the engineering or manufacturing sectors. You will be highly organised with good customer service and communication skills. Applicants will be confident, have a reasonably technical mindset and possess excellent organisational skills. You must be computer literate and ideally have had some exposure to supporting online marketing, e.g. uploading images to websites, supporting production of web-based/marketing and technical brochures.
Hours of Work: Mon - Fri 40 hours
Benefits: Excellent basic salary £33K - £38K Negotiable, Bonus, Pension, 33 days annual leave, Sick pay.
